Recently I have noticed a bit of shedding in the front. Looking in the mirror the front appears thinner than prior to starting the Theradome treatments. Not sure if that is true, but it certainly appears that way. It's safe to say it's not a good sign when after 37 weeks of LLLT (Theradome usage) there is debate on if the hair looks worse than before. I have decided to scale back my use of the Theradome to two treatments per week.
The majority of those who I have kept in touch with since the beginning are in a similar situation. A few think their hair has worsened, a few others think they may see some improvement and the rest see no notable change. In my opinion none have experienced anything to the scale of what Theradome claims on Theradome.com |
